Overview

The HLA-A*02:01-MART-1 peptide complex is a molecular assembly formed by the Human Leukocyte Antigen (HLA) allele A*02:01 and a processed peptide fragment derived from the Melanoma Antigen Recognized by T cells 1 (MART-1), also known as Melan-A (Kawakami et al., 1994, PNAS). This complex is primarily expressed on the surface of melanocytes and melanoma cells, where it serves as a critical recognition element for the immune system by binding to specific T-cell receptors (TCRs) on CD8+ cytotoxic T lymphocytes (UniProt MLANA Q16655). In clinical oncology, this complex is a major target for cancer immunotherapies, particularly adoptive cell transfer using TCR-engineered T cells (TCR-T) and peptide-based vaccines (Morgan et al., 2006, Science). Because MART-1 is a lineage-specific differentiation antigen, it is highly expressed in the majority of melanomas, providing a broad therapeutic target for HLA-A*02:01-positive patients. However, the presence of MART-1 in healthy melanocytes in the skin, eye, and inner ear can lead to on-target, off-tumor toxicities such as vitiligo, uveitis, and hearing loss (Johnson et al., 2009, Blood). Current research focuses on enhancing the affinity of TCRs for this complex while managing systemic inflammatory responses like cytokine release syndrome.

Mechanism of action

The complex acts as a ligand for specific T-cell receptors (TCRs) on CD8+ T cells; drug interaction typically involves engineering T cells to express these TCRs or using vaccines to expand endogenous T cells, leading to cytotoxic lysis of the presenting cell via perforin and granzyme release.
